  The GD Library is a fun resource to play with. You can make a complex clock or draw a simple line. With lots of stuff in between. Most servers that support PHP (any version) will probably have some version of the GD Library installed.
  Most of the CCP scripts you find here will be pretty basic. I feel that the best way to learn something like this is to play with it. You will see many comment tags in these scripts. That is where I added notes to try to explain what something does.

 TIP'S & HINT'S



Once you output & upload/download your image as a PNG/JPG you can take it to ImageMagick & make the background transparent. But remember = depending on the color used some will look good on a light backgroud & bad on a dark one. (& vice versa) Just play with the script to get it just the way "YOU" want it. ~DAVE
